However, I like to be proved wrong every now and then so this Sunday, I might just go down to Tribute to take Chef Ashton’s Mexican Cooking Class for novice chefs ($698 per person) He plans to demonstrate how to make crab quesadillas, refried beans, prawn tacos, crab tostadas, etc, etc. The fiesta starts at seven and the demo is followed by a three-course dinner featuring the dishes shown.
